Course Content

• Fourteenth Amendment: History and Jurisprudence
• Equal Protection Clause: Analysis and Application
• Strict Scrutiny, Intermediate Scrutiny, and Rational Basis Review
• Fourteenth Amendment and Discrimination: Race, Ethnicity, and National Origin
• Gender Equality under the Fourteenth Amendment
• Disability Rights and the Fourteenth Amendment: ADA and Related Legislation
• Due Process Clause and its Interaction with Equal Protection
• Remedies for Fourteenth Amendment Violations
• Current Issues in Fourteenth Amendment Equal Rights Legislation
